Also the centrifugal force produced by the revolutions of the earth and moon and the earth and sun around their common center of mass WebJul 8, 2024 · The Moon’s gravity affects us so much that it is elongating our days. Scientists predict that some 1.4 billion years ago, a day on Earth was only 18 hours long. This is because the moon revolved much closer to us at that time than it does today.
